Настройка QGIS

QGIS гибко настраивается при помощи меню Установки. Здесь можно изменить настройки панелей инструментов, свойства проекта и настроить внешний вид QGIS.

Панели инструментов

В меню Панели‣ можно отключить неиспользуемые элементы QGIS. Меню Панели инструментов ‣ позволяет скрывать и отображать группы кнопок на панелях инструментов (см. figure_panels_toolbars).

Figure Panels and Toolbars:

../../../_images/panels_and_toolbars.png

Меню «Панели инструментов» nix

Совет

Обзорная карта

In QGIS you can use an overview panel that provides a full extent view of layers added to it. It can be selected under the menu View ‣ Panels. Within the view is a rectangle showing the current map extent. This allows you to quickly determine which area of the map you are currently viewing. Note that labels are not rendered to the map overview even if the layers in the map overview have been set up for labeling. If you click and drag the red rectangle in the overview that shows your current extent, the main map view will update accordingly.

Совет

Отладочные сообщения

У вас есть возможность просматривать отладочные сообщения. Чтобы увидеть панель отладочных сообщений активируйте флажок checkbox Отладочные сообщения в меню Вид ‣ Панели. По мере поступления сообщений они будут отображаться во вкладках Общие и Модули.

Свойства проекта

In the properties window for the project under nix Project ‣ Project Properties or win Project ‣ Project Properties you set project specific options. These include:

  • На вкладке Общие определяется заглавие проекта, цвет выделения и фона, единицы слоя, точность, и параметр сохранения относительных путей к слоям. Если включено преобразование координат — можно выбрать эллипсоид для вычисления расстояний. Кроме того, здесь можно задать единицы измерения карты (используются только при отключенном преобразовании координат). В случае необходимости можно задать масштабный ряд, отличный от используемого по умолчанию.

  • Вкладка Система координат позволяет выбрать систему координат для данного проекта и включить преобразование координат векторных и растровых слоёв «на лету», если используются слои с разными системами координат.

  • C помощью третьей вкладки Определяемые слои можно настроить (или отключить) то, какие слои будут реагировать на инструмент «Определить объекты» (cм. параграф «Инструменты карты» в разделе Параметры для включения определения нескольких слоев).

  • Вкладка Стандартные стили позволяет настроить отображение слоёв, которые не имеют связанного с ними стиля. Здесь же можно настроить прозрачность для добавляемых слоёв и включить присвоение случайных цветов новым знакам.

  • Вкладка Сервер OWS позволяет задать характеристики сервера QGIS, ограничения охвата и поддерживаемые системы координат.

  • Вкладка Макросы служит для создания макросов уровня проекта, которые будут выполняться при открытии, сохранении и закрытии проекта.

Figure Macro Menu:

../../../_images/macro.png

Настройка макросов в QGIS

Параметры

mActionOptions Некоторые основные параметры QGIS могут быть определены в диалоговом окне Параметры. Выберите пункт меню Установки ‣ mActionOptions Параметры. Параметры можно изменить на следующих вкладках:

Владка «Общие»

Приложение

  • Выбрать Тема интерфейса (требуется перезапуск QGIS) selectstring из «Oxygen», «Windows», «Motif», «CDE», «Plastique» и «Cleanlooks».

  • Задать Тема значков selectstring. Доступна только тема «default».

  • Настроить Размер значков selectstring.

  • Выбрать Шрифт. Доступны варианты radiobuttonon Системный и заданный пользователем.

  • Изменить Время показа диалогов и сообщений состояния selectstring.

  • checkbox Не показывать заставку при запуске

  • checkbox Показывать совет дня при запуске

  • checkbox Выделять заголовки групп виджетов

  • checkbox Оформлять группы виджетов в стиле QGIS

  • checkbox Изменять цвета в реальном времени

Файлы проектов

  • При запуске открывать проект selectstring (можно выбрать «Новый», «Последний» и «Указанный». Если выбран «Указаный», используйте кнопку browsebutton чтобы указать проект)

  • checkbox Создавать новый проект из шаблона по умолчанию. Здесь же можно [Сохранить текущий проект как стандартный шаблон] или [Удалить шаблон] и восстановить значение по умолчанию. Ниже находится поле, где задаётся каталог шаблонов проектов. Шаблоны из этого каталога будут отображаться в меню Проект ‣ Создать из шаблона.

  • checkbox Запрашивать сохранение изменений в проекте и источниках данных, когда это необходимо

  • checkbox Предупреждать при попытке открытия файлов проекта старых версий |qg|

  • Разрешить макросы selectstring. Позволяет настроить поведение программы при открытии проектов с макросами.

Можно выбрать один из вариантов: «Не разрешать», «Спрашивать», «Разрешить на время текущего сеанса» и «Всегда разрешать (не рекомендуется)».

Вкладка «Система»

Переменные среды

На вкладке Система также можно просматривать и редактировать переменные окружения (см. рисунок figure_environment_variables).Это особенно полезно на таких системах, как Mac, где графические приложения не обязательно наследуют окружение пользователя. Также может применяться для настройки переменных окружения сторонних инструментов, использумых в Processing Toolbox, например SAGA, GRASS и др.

  • checkbox Переопределить переменные среды (требуется перезапуск). Используйте кнопки [Добавить] и [Удалить] для редактирования переменных окружения. Ниже отображаются Текущие переменные среды, активировав флажок checkbox Показывать только специфичные для QGIS переменные его можно значительно сократить.

Figure System Environment:

../../../_images/sys-env-options.png

Просмотр переменных окружения в QGIS

Модули

  • [Добавить] или [Удалить] Пути поиска дополнительных модулей

Вкладка «Источники данных»

Таблица атрибутов

  • checkbox Открывать таблицу аттрибутов во встраиваемом окне (требуется перезапуск)

  • checkbox Копировать геометрию в формате WKT из таблицы атрибутов. При использовании функции mActionCopySelectedКопировать выделенные строки в буфер обмена атрибутивной таблицы, будет также скопировано и WKT-представление геометрии объекта.

  • Вид таблицы атрибутов selectstring. Доступно три варианта: «Все объекты», «Выделенные объекты» и «Видимые объекты».

  • Размер кеша таблицы атрибутов (строк) selectnumber. Кэш таблицы атрибутов используется для хранения N последних загруженных строк, что ускоряет работу. Кэш очищается при закрытии таблицы атрибутов.

  • Представление значений NULL. Здесь задаётся представление полей содержащих значения NULL.

Источники данных

  • Искать источники данных в панели обозревателя selectstring. Предлагается два метода: «По расширению» и «По содержимому».

  • Сканировать содержимое архивов (.zip) в панели обозревателя selectstring. Возможные варианты: «Пропускать», «Быстрое сканирование» и «Полное сканирование».

  • Запрашивать загрузку дочерних слоёв растра. Некоторые растровые форматы поддерживают вложенные слои — в GDAL они называются дочерними (subdatasets). В качестве примера можно привести файлы netCDF — если в файле присутствует несколько переменных, то GDAL каждую из них считает отдельным слоем. Эта настройка определяет поведение QGIS при открытии таких файлов. Возможны следующие варианты:

    • Всегда: всегда спрашивать (если в файле есть дочерние слои)

    • Если необходимо: спрашивать, если в слое нет каналов, но есть дочерние слои

    • Никогда: никогда не спрашивать, дочерние слои не загружаются

    • Загружать всё: никогда не спрашивать, сразу загружать все дочерние слои

  • checkbox Игнорировать объявленную кодировку shape-файлов. Если shape-файл содержит информацию о кодировке, она будет игнорироваться QGIS.

  • checkbox Добавлять слои PostGIS двойным щелчком и включить расширенную выборку

  • checkbox Добавлять слои Oracle двойным щелчком и включить расширенную выборку

Вкладка «Отрисовка»

Параметры отрисовки

  • checkbox Рисовать сглаженные линии (снижает скорость отрисовки)

  • checkbox Исправлять ошибки заливки полигонов

Растры

  • Каналы отображения в RGB позволяют указать номера каналов, которые будут использованы как красный, зелёный и синий каналы.

Улучшение контраста

  • Одноканальное серое selectstring. Одноканальные изображения в оттенках серого могут использовать следущие алгоритмы улучшения контраста: «Без растяжения», «Растяжение до мин/макс», «Растяжение и отсечение по мин/макс» и «Отсечение по мин/макс»

  • Многоканальное (байт/канал) selectstring. Поддерживаются следущие алгоритмы улучшения контраста: «Без растяжения», «Растяжение до мин/макс», «Растяжение и отсечение по мин/макс» и «Отсечение по мин/макс».

  • Многоканальное (>байт/канал) selectstring. Поддерживаются следущие алгоритмы улучшения контраста: «Без растяжения», «Растяжение до мин/макс», «Растяжение и отсечение по мин/макс» и «Отсечение по мин/макс».

  • Предельные значения (мин/макс) selectstring. Доступны: ‘Срез с накоплением’, ‘Минимум/максимум’, ‘Среднее +/- стандартное отклонение’

  • Границы среза с накоплением

  • Множитель стандартного отклонения

Отладка

  • Показывать в журнале следующие события: checkbox Обновление карты

Вкладка «Карта и легенда»

Внешний вид по умолчанию

  • Установить Цвет выделения selectcolor и Цвет фона selectcolor.

Легенда

  • По двойному щелчку на слое в легенде selectstring можно открывать свойства слоя или открывать таблицу атрибутов.

  • Доступны следующие настройки элементов легенды:

    • checkbox Выводить имена слоёв с прописной буквы

    • checkbox Выделять слои полужирным шрифтом

    • checkbox Выделять группы полужирным шрифтом

    • checkbox Показывать в легенде атрибуты классификации

    • checkbox Создавать значки для растровых слоёв

    • checkbox Добавлять новые слои в выбранную или текущую группу

Вкладка «Инструменты»

Инструмент определения

  • checkbox Открывать результаты определения во встраиваемом окне (требуется перезапуск)

  • Настройка Режим определения selectstring используется для указания того, какие слои будут показываться при использовании инструмента «Определить объекты».При выборе «Сверху вниз» или «Сверху вниз, до первого найденного» вместо «Текущий слой», при использовании инструмента «Определить объекты» будут показаны атрибуты всех определяемых слоев (см. раздел Проекты, параграф «Свойства проекта» для настройки определяемых слоев).

  • checkbox Открывать форму, если найден один объект

  • установить Радиус поиска для определения объектов и всплывающих описаний (задается в процентах от ширины видимой карты)

Инструмент измерений

  • Установить Цвет линии для инструментов измерений

  • Установить число Десятичных знаков

  • checkbox Сохранять базовые единицы

  • Единицы измерения по умолчанию radiobuttonon (метры или футы)

  • Единицы измерения углов radiobuttonon (градусы, радианы или грады)

Прокрутка и масштабирование

  • Задать Действие при прокрутке колеса мыши selectstring («Увеличить», «Увеличить и центрировать», «Увеличить в положении курсора», «Ничего»)

  • Установить Фактор увеличения для колеса мыши

Масштабный ряд

Здесь находится масштабдный для. Кнопки [+] и [-] позволяют добавлять и удалять отдельные элементы списка.

Вкладка «Оцифровка»

Создание объектов

  • checkbox Отключить всплывающее окно ввода атрибутов для каждого создаваемого объекта

  • checkbox Использовать последние введённые значения

  • Проверка геометрии. Редактирование сложных линий/полигонов с большим количеством узлов может замедлить отрисовку. Это происходит из-за того, что процедура проверки геометрии, используемая в QGIS по умолчанию довольно медленная. Ускорить отрисовку можно либо используя для проверки геометрии библиотеку GEOS (начиная с GEOS 3.3) или отключив её вообще. Проверка геометрии при помощи GEOS намного быстрее, но у нее есть недостаток — обнаруживается только первая проблема с геометрией.

Резиновая нить

  • Установить Толщину линии selectnumber и Цвет линии selectcolor для «резиновой нити»

Прилипание

  • checkbox Открывать параметры прилипания во встраиваемом окне (требуется перезапуск)

  • Установить Режим прилипания по умолчанию selectstring («К вершинам», «К сегментам», «К вершинам и сегментам», «Выключена»)

  • Установить Порог прилипания по умолчанию в единицах карты или пикселях

  • Установить Радиус поиска для редактирования вершин selectnumber (в единицах карты или пикселях)

Маркеры вершин

  • checkbox Показывать маркеры только для выбранных объектов

  • Установить Стиль маркера selectstring («Перекрестие» (по умолчанию), «Полупрозрачный круг» или «Без маркера»)

  • Задать Размер маркера selectnumber.

Параллельные кривые

Следующие три параметра относятся к инструменту mActionOffsetCurve Параллельная кривая, описанному в разделе Дополнительные функции оцифровки. При помощи этих настроек можно управлять видом параллельной кривой. Все эти настройки будут учитываться только при использовании GEOS 3.3 или более поздней версии.

  • Стиль соединения параллельной линии

  • Количество сегментов на квадрант selectnumber

  • Предел острия параллельной кривой

Вкладка «GDAL»

Библиотека GDAL предназначена для работы с растровыми данными. На этой вкладке можно настроить [Параметры создания] и [Параметры пирамид], а также указать какой именно драйвер GDAL необходимо использовать для открытия файлов, если данный формат поддерживается более чем одним драйвером.

Вкладка «Система координат»

Система координат для новых проектов

  • checkbox Включать перепроецирование при добавлении слоёв в другой системе координат

  • checkbox Включить преобразование координат «на лету»

  • Создавать новые проекты в указанной системе координат

Система координат для новых слоёв

Вторая группа позволяет определить поведение QGIS при создании нового слоя или при загрузке слоя с неопределенной системой координат.

  • radiobuttonon Запрашивать систему координат

  • radiobuttonoff Использовать систему координат проекта

  • radiobuttonon Использовать указанную систему координат

Язык

  • checkbox Переопределить системный язык и Язык, используемый вместо системного

  • Дополнительная информация о системном языке

Сеть

Общие

  • Задать Адрес поиска WMS-серверов,по умолчанию используется http://geopole.org/wms/search?search=\%1\&type=rss

  • Установить Таймаут для сетевых запросов (мс). Значение по умолчанию — 60000

  • Настроить Время актуальности данных WMS-C/WMTS по умолчанию (часы). Значение по умолчанию —- 24 часа.

Figure Network Tab:

../../../_images/proxy-settings.png

Настройка прокси-сервера в QGIS

Параметры кэширования

Задать Каталог и Размер кэша.

  • checkbox Использовать прокси-сервер для внешних соединений и настроить поля «Узел», «Порт», «Пользователь», и «Пароль».

  • Установить Тип прокси selectstring в соответствии с конфигурацией сети.

    • Default Proxy: прокси определяется настройками приложения

    • Socks5Proxy: Общий прокси для любого вида связи. Поддерживаются TCP, UDP, привязка к порту (входящие соединения) и авторизация

    • HttpProxy: реализован с использованием команды «СONNECT», поддерживает только исходящие TCP соединения; поддерживает авторизацию

    • HttpCachingProxy: использует стандартные команды HTTP, имеет смысл использовать только с запросами HTTP

    • FtpCachingProxy: реализован посредством FTP прокси, имеет смысл использовать только с запросами FTP

Если вы не хотите использовать прокси-сервер для некоторых адресов, можно добавить их в текстовое поле ниже (см. Figure_Network_Tab).

Для получения более детальной информации о различных настройках прокси-сервера, обратитесь к Руководству Qt-library-documentation по адресу http://qt-project.org/doc/qt-4.8/qnetworkproxy.html#ProxyType-enum.

Совет

Использование прокси-серверов

Использование прокси-серверов иногда может быть довольно сложным. Для проверки вышеописанных типов прокси, действуйте методом «проб и ошибок», проверяя в каждом случае успешность соединений.

Можно настроить параметры в соответствии со своими потребностями. Внесение некоторых изменений может потребовать перезапуска QGIS для их применения.

  • nix параметры сохраняются в текстовом файле: $HOME/.config/QGIS/qgis2.conf

  • osx ваши настройки можно найти в файле: $HOME/Library/Preferences/org.qgis.qgis.plist

  • win параметры хранятся в ветке системного реестра: HKEY\CURRENT_USER\Software\QGIS\qgis2

Настройка интерфейса

Диалог Настройка интерфейса позволяет (де)активировать практически любой элемент графического интерфейса QGIS. Такая возможность может быть полезной, если у вас установлено множество модулей, которые не используются, но занимают место на панелях.

Figure Customization 1:

../../../_images/customization.png

Диалог «Настройка интерфейса» nix

Все настройки интерфеса разбиты на пять групп. В разделе checkbox Menus настраивается видимость элементов главного меню. В разделе checkbox Panels собраны все плавающие окна. Плавающие окна это различные диалоги, которые после запуска могут быть размещены в любом месте экрана или встроенны в основное окно QGIS (см. также Панели инструментов). Группа checkbox StatusBar позволяет деактивировать элементы строки состояния, например, поле с системой координат. В разделе checkbox Toolbars можно (де)активировать различные кнопки на панелях инструментов и, наконец, в группе checkbox Widgets можно отключить или включить как целые диалоги, так и отдельные их элементы.

При помощи инструмента mActionSelect Выбрать элементы управления в приложении можно выбирать элементы интерфейса QGIS, которые необходимо скрыть, и быстро находить их в списке элементов (см. figure_customization). Различные варианты настройки можно сохранить для дальнейшего использования. Чтобы сделанные изменения вступили в силу, необходимо перезапустить QGIS.